ドメインネームサービス (DNS) とは
更新 2025年2月4日
ドメインネームサービス (DNS) はインターネットの住所録のようなもので、人間にとってわかりやすいドメイン名を、コンピュータが互いを識別するために使用する数値のIPアドレスに変換します。
ドメインネームサービスの意味
デジタル環境におけるドメインネームサービスは、ユーザーがウェブサイトにアクセスする方法を簡素化します。ウェブサイトにアクセスするたびに長い数字の列を入力することを想像してみてください。面倒ですよね?DNSは、'example.com'のようなキャッチーなドメイン名をコンピュータが容易に理解できるIPアドレスに変換することで、この問題を解決します。
ドメインネームサービスの仕組み
ブラウザにウェブアドレスを入力するたびに、DNSクエリが始まります。このプロセスは、DNSサーバーを介した一連のステップを含みます。最初に、コンピュータはローカルキャッシュを参照します。もし一致するものが見つからなければ、DNSリゾルバーに問い合わせ、さらに他のDNSサーバーにクエリを送信し、ルート、トップレベルドメイン (TLD) サーバー、最終的に権威ネームサーバーを通じてナビゲートします。対応するIPアドレスが見つかると、ドメインが解決され、目的のウェブサイトがロードされます。
DNS: ユーザーエクスペリエンスの向上
デジタルインフラストラクチャにおいてドメインネームサービスがなければ、ウェブサイトへのアクセスは現在のようにスムーズではありません。DNSはドメイン名をIPアドレスに変換することで、ユーザーがウェブサイトを簡単に見つけられるようにし、全体的なユーザーエクスペリエンスを向上させます。DNSはウェブサイトを覚えやすくするだけでなく、インターネットの機能にとって重要なセキュリティと安定性の層も提供します。
ドメインネームサービスのセキュリティ側面
ドメインネームサービスはセキュリティにおいても重要な役割を果たします。DNSセキュリティ拡張 (DNSSEC) はデータの信頼性を強化し、キャッシュポイズニング攻撃のような脅威を軽減します。さらに、定期的なパフォーマンス改善により、インターネットインフラストラクチャ内でのドメインネームサービスが堅牢で信頼性のある状態を維持します。
ネットワークにおけるドメインネームサービスの説明
ドメインネームサービスが何を達成するのかを理解することで、ネットワークにおけるその重要性についての洞察が得られます。それはインターネットの使いやすさの基盤であり、複雑な数値IPアドレスを認識可能な名前に変換し、サイトへのアクセスを容易にします。その効率的な機能は、ブラウジングからバンキングに至るまで、無数のオンライン活動を支え、デジタルエコシステムの重要な部分となっています。
ドメインネームサービスは、しばしばDNSと略され、広大なウェブ環境内でドメイン名を解決することにより、ネットワーク運用の継続性と効率性を支えます。インターネットを利用するたびに期待されるシームレスな体験を可能にする重要な技術として存在します。DNS技術の絶え間ない進化は、現代のインターネット利用の増大する要求と課題に対応できるようにしています。